Watervale suburb profile
Watervale is a picturesque town nestled in the Clare Valley wine region of South Australia, renowned for its stunning landscapes and premium vineyards. This charming rural community offers a tranquil lifestyle, with a strong emphasis on viticulture and agriculture. Watervale is celebrated for its Riesling wines, with the famous Riesling Trail passing through the area, attracting wine enthusiasts and cyclists alike. The town's historic buildings, local cellar doors, and welcoming atmosphere make it a delightful destination for visitors seeking a taste of country life. Its scenic beauty and thriving wine industry contribute to Watervale's unique appeal.

Watervale demographics
Watervale, nestled in the picturesque Clare Valley of South Australia, is a charming rural suburb known for its vineyards, rolling hills, and tranquil lifestyle. With a small population of just 338, Watervale offers a close-knit community atmosphere where residents enjoy the peace and beauty of country living. The median age of 43 suggests a mature population, with many families and long-term residents who appreciate the area's serene environment and strong sense of community.
The suburb's housing landscape is characterized by a high rate of home ownership, with 44.3% of properties owned outright and 39.1% owned with a mortgage. This reflects a stable community with a significant number of residents committed to long-term living in the area. Rental properties are less common, comprising only 16.5% of the housing market, which may appeal to those seeking a more permanent residence in a rural setting.
Family life in Watervale is vibrant, with couple families with children making up 46% of the households, closely followed by couple families without children at 47%. The presence of one-parent families is minimal, at just 7%, and there are no other family types recorded. Watervale infrastructure, key developments and investment opportunities
Watervale’s profile as a boutique wine village in the Clare Valley continues to underpin local property demand, with its proximity to renowned Riesling vineyards and cellar doors supporting tourism-related jobs and lifestyle appeal.[1][4][6] The township benefits from its position on the Horrocks Highway between Auburn and Clare, giving residents convenient access to larger centres for schooling, retail and health services while retaining a quiet rural character.[4][6] Ongoing investment in wine, hospitality and agritourism operations in the broader Clare Valley is likely to sustain demand for both residential and small-acreage lifestyle properties in and around Watervale.[6]
Local amenities such as the post office and community services, along with easy driving access to parks, walking trails and outdoor recreation across the Clare Valley, contribute to Watervale’s livability for families and retirees.[2][6][10] There are currently no widely publicised major new infrastructure, transport or school projects specific to Watervale itself, so near- to medium-term property trends are expected to remain driven primarily by regional tourism, agricultural performance and general Clare Valley market conditions.[1][4][6]
